Drier end of the week

...for most places anyway. Lingering moisture and afternoon heating could still lead to a few showers and storms today, but much of the I-10 corridor from Houston to Lafayette will be much drier today and tomorrow. Opelousas to Lafayette might see a big cluster of storms that will form to the north come pretty close this evening, but it looks like it'll stay off to the north and east.


This weekend looks more interesting, mainly for Texas. Big clusters of storms will fire over central Texas and spread eastward Friday night and Saturday. How far east their impacts will carry is still very uncertain. They'll be capable of strong wind gusts and heavy rain though. Latest thinking is most of the impacts will stay west of Houston through Saturday, but thunderstorms could become more likely Saturday night and Sunday.
